SUNY Polytechnic Institute
Cost & Tuition
In-State Tuition: $8,578
In-State Cost of Attendance: $23,018
Out-of-State Tuition: $20,228
Out-of-State Cost of Attendance: $34,668
Student Debt
Median total debt: $12,000
Students with federal loans: 40.6%
Students with Pell grants: 36.7%
Career Outcomes
All graduates median earnings:
After 1 year: $55,116
After 5 years: $70,849

Institution Details
Undergraduate Enrollment: 1,773 students
Admission Rate: 78.4%
Retention Rate: 68.3%
Graduation Rate: 59.2%
